State Laws

(0 reviews)
State Motorcycle helmet use governs: Does the motorcycle helmet law cover all low-power cycles? Bicycle helmet use governs:
Alabama all riders yes 15 and younger
Alaska 17 and younger yes no law
Arizona 17 and younger some no law
Arkansas 20 and younger yes no law
California all riders yes 17 and younger
Colorado 17 and younger and passengers 17 and younger yes no law
Connecticut 17 and younger yes 15 and younger
Delaware 18 and younger some 17 and younger
District of Columbia all riders some 15 and younger
Florida 20 and younger some 15 and younger
Georgia all riders some 15 and younger
Hawaii 17 and younger some 15 and younger
Idaho 17 and younger some no law
Illinois no law no law no law
Indiana 17 and younger yes no law
Iowa no law no law no law
Kansas 17 and younger some no law
Kentucky 20 and younger some no law
Louisiana all riders yes 11 and younger
Maine 17 and younger some 15 and younger
Maryland all riders some 15 and younger
Massachusetts all riders yes 1-16 (riding with children
younger than 1 prohibited)
Michigan 20 and younger some no law
Minnesota 17 and younger yes no law
Mississippi all riders yes no law
Missouri all riders some no law
Montana 17 and younger some no law
Nebraska all riders yes no law
Nevada all riders some no law
New Hampshire no law no law 15 and younger
New Jersey all riders yes 16 and younger
New Mexico 17 and younger some 17 and younger
New York all riders some 1-13 (riding with children
younger than 1 prohibited)
North Carolina all riders yes 15 and younger
North Dakota 17 and younger yes no law
Ohio 17 and younger yes no law
Oklahoma 17 and younger some no law
Oregon all riders yes 15 and younger
Pennsylvania 20 and younger some 11 and younger
Rhode Island 20 and younger some 15 and younger
South Carolina 20 and younger yes no law
South Dakota 17 and younger yes no law
Tennessee all riders yes 15 and younger
Texas 20 and younger some no law
Utah 17 and younger yes no law
Vermont all riders some no law
Virginia all riders some no law
Washington all riders yes no law
West Virginia all riders some 14 and younger
Wisconsin 17 and younger some no law
Wyoming 17 and younger some no law
Information taken from iihs.gov December, 2011. Please check for current state laws before traveling.
